Job Description Lead Medical Technologist Brighton, MA

Base Salary Range - $61,000 - $88,000 per year plus benefits

POSITION SUMMARY: Under the direction of the Blood Bank Supervisor provides the technical and quality leadership for the Blood Bank Laboratory. Responsibilities include performing routine and specialty bench testing, ensuring quality and regulatory compliance, accurate performance of all procedures, coordinating staff scheduling and workload,, inventory and ordering of supplies, training of new personnel and ongoing competency assessment, instrument maintenance and troubleshooting, creation and maintenance of procedures, quality assurance data collection and analysis, and performance of record review. Collaborates and effectively communicates with Blood Bank staff, Laboratory Management and technical staff, physicians, other health care professionals and patients.

ESSENTIAL RESPONSIBILITIES / DUTIES: Assigned responsibilities: Reviews and evaluates daily and periodic Quality Control testing and procedures. Ensures performance of periodic instrument maintenance and departmental quality control procedures. Coordinates CAP survey performance and reporting. Assists with creation of validation plans as may be required for equipment or procedures, and ensures completion of validation package for final review. Performs Meditech validation exercises as may be required with system upgrades or site specific changes. Ensures department is prepared for planned Meditech downtime. Monitors transfusion activity at contracted transfusion service client sites for regulatory compliance; may be required to make periodic site visits. Acts as liaison with Nursing Education to evaluate and/or update mandatory training material. May be asked to assist with creating lessons. Assists with ensuring Blood Bank policies are appropriately posted to SEMC MCN Policy Manager. Ensures blood product inventory levels are adequate for transfusion support and works to reduce product wastage. Tracks data for quality improvement monitors as defined by Blood Bank Supervisor.

Assist in the collection and preparation of Continuous Quality Improvement (CQI) projects. Offers ideas for future CQI projects that will benefit the department and hospital. Actively participates in the Hospital Performance Improvement Program. May act as Blood Bank representative at interdepartmental/interdisciplinary meetings or for collaborative projects. Observes functions of the section, and makes suggestions on ways to better streamline operations.

Oversees the administration of proficiency testing and ensures participation of all staff. Assists in the reviewing of policies and procedures, advising on and creating Standard Operating Procedures (SOPs).

Retrieves, compiles, prepares and processes reports and logs (statistical, management, patient, client) as appropriate: Monitors Turnaround time for identified tests Reviews daily specimen review log for accuracy.
